Montre de poche par George Prior
Watch: England, London, late 18th century for the Ottoman market. Silver case: Ottoman Empire, 19th century Double silver case. White enamel dial inscribed "George Prior, London" and Turkish numerals. Gilt mechanism inscribed "Geo. Prior London 8178". Dial without glass. Silver case finely chased with a panoply of Arts and a Trophy, and scalloped edge. Apocryphal English silver hallmarks "with lion" without date letter or city hallmark, and Armenian hallmark. Inscription engraved inside the case: "M30 01 99D Paris". Expert L.S. H. : 7 cm ; D. : 5,8 cm George Prior was a watchmaker, specialized in watches and clocks for the Ottoman market, active between 1765 and 1812.
